2.4.8
PARITY
The PARITY submenu is used to set or modify the byte format and parity type for
RS-232-C serial communication between the cutter and the host computer.
The default parity setting is bit 8 = 0 (8 data bits, no parity, the 8th bit being a
low bit). The parity can be set to any of the following values:
LCD information
Parity setting
Remarks
BIT 8 = 0
8 data bits, no parity
bit 8 = low (0)
BIT 8 = 1
8 data bits, no parity
bit 8 = high (1)
EVEN
7 data bits, 1 parity bit
parity bit = even
ODD
7 data bits, 1 parity bit
parity bit = odd
The active parity setting is marked with an asterisk (
¾
) on the LCD.
NOTE
The cutter’s parity setting
MUST
match the host computer's parity
setting.
2.4.9
RTS/DTR
The RTS/DTR submenu controls the Request To Send (RTS) and Data Terminal
Ready (DTR) signals for the cutter's RS-232-C serial communications interface for
hardware handshaking.
RTS/DTR can be set to TOGGLE (hardware handshaking) or HIGH (software
handshaking).
The RTS/DTR default value is TOGGLE.
The active handshake setting is marked with an asterisk (
¾
) on the LCD.
